Summary
MOVIETONE CARD TITLE: Will South Africa Win the Rubber. SHOTLIST: Shots of the S Africans practising. Close shot of Wade the skipper. Shot of Mitchell batting at nets also CU. CU of another player ?? name. CU North. Shot of Cameron playing. Also CU. Various other shots of the players but the names are not distinct.
